1. Start with the right geographic definition
West Bradford is recorded as a municipal-town in Chester County, Pennsylvania. That distinction matters when you review a dashboard: West Bradford township, Chester County, nearby municipalities, and a broader Pennsylvania market are not interchangeable reporting scopes. The population estimate for West Bradford is useful as eligibility and location context only. It cannot tell you how many people need legal help, how many search online, or how many prospective clients a marketing channel may produce. Recommended approach
Write down the exact geography for each decision: West Bradford township, Chester County, another named area, or Pennsylvania. Then ask whether rankings, calls, forms and matters can be reviewed against that same definition. If a dashboard view combines areas, require a clear explanation of the combination before treating the total as local performance.
